NO UPWARD CHAIN!

Situated on a very popular address close to schooling and local amenities, this three-bedroom semi-detached home is beautifully presented throughout and offers excellent family accommodation with scope for some cosmetic updating. The property benefits from a generous driveway, garage and a well-sized rear garden.

As you step in through the porch into the entrance hall, you are led through to the full-length living dining room. This bright and spacious room features a bay window to the front, a gas fireplace and sliding doors through to the conservatory, which enjoys views over the garden and provides a lovely additional reception space. The kitchen is positioned to the rear and is fitted with wall and base units, an integrated fridge, freezer, oven and gas hob, along with space for a washing machine. There is a useful pantry for extra storage and a door providing direct access to the garden.

Upstairs, there are three well-proportioned bedrooms. Bedroom one is positioned to the front of the property and benefits from fitted wardrobes. Bedroom two is located to the rear and also includes fitted storage, while bedroom three is to the front and offers further built-in storage. The shower room comprises a corner shower and wash hand basin, along with an airing cupboard housing the boiler, and there is a separate WC adjacent.

Externally, the property offers a generous private driveway providing off-road parking for multiple vehicles and leading to both the front door and the garage, which is ideal for storage. The front garden is gravelled for ease of maintenance. To the rear is a mainly lawned garden with patio areas, space for a shed and borders filled with shrubs and planting, creating a pleasant outdoor space.

We are advised by our client that the property is Freehold, Council Tax Band - D and EPC rating - D.

Bartlams Estate Agents were formed in 1935 by Reginald Bartlam and have been dealing with house sales and lettings ever since, making us one of the oldest independent Estate Agents in Wolverhampton for over 80 years! Our legacy of excellence spans years, earning us a distinguished reputation of unparalleled professionalism, and unfaltering reliability. Currently, our Partners oversee three village-located offices plus a further seven-branch network with over 35 members of professionally trained agents, making us one of the most established team of property experts in the area. This means the people who own the Company, run it daily and are responsible for all aspects of its growth, success, and professionalism. When you're ready to take the next step towards your dream home or make a savvy investment, we're your trusted partner, every step of the journey. Did you know? We were famous in the 1930's for the Bartlams Big Band! Founder Mr Bartlam was a keen musician, and his band represented the Wolverhampton area in national competitions. Unfortunately, the outbreak of war in 1939 eventually led to its disbandment, although the band was fondly remembered locally for many years after! ‘
